           Summary: Missing symbols in object file if template
                    instantiated inside `with`

--- Comment #0 from Denis Shelomovskij <verylonglogin.reg@gmail.com> 2013-02-07 23:15:22 MSK ---
---
enum E { x }

void g(T)() { }

void main()
{
    with(E) g!int();
}
---

OPTLINK output:
---
OPTLINK (R) for Win32  Release 8.00.12
...
 Error 42: Symbol Undefined _D4main9__T1gTAiZ1gFNaNbNfAiZE4main1E
---

The source of such link failures is not just unexpected and hard to reduce. Worst of all one will likely think this is one of "unfixable" OPTLINK buffer overflow bugs making D unusable on Windows (or is it a cross-platform issue?).
